Level_13: Cheat Codes
The fifth biennial installment of Altered Esthetics’ classic video game art exhibit will also highlight the abandoned or obsolete technology of decades past.
Fourteen artists reinterpret their favorite video games including Contra, Super Mario, PacMan, and Zelda in the form of paintings, photographs and jewelry. All are welcome to join in the artists' discussion on Saturday, April 14. We'll ask the artists about their work, and reminisce about favorite games.

Altered Esthetics is a nonprofit 501(c)3 community gallery run by artists, for
artists. Bringing together dimensional art, music, poetry, performance art, and film, we are one of the most creatively diverse galleries in the Twin Cities. Altered Esthetics holds group-shows so that multiple artists of all backgrounds can display their perspectives on a given theme, and works to sustain the historical role of artists as a true voice of society through exhibits, events, services, workshops, and programs.
